Subject: Quickstore 4.2 — bloom filter now fronts the KV layer

Plugin authors: starting with this release, Quickstore places a bloom filter ahead of the key-value store. Negative lookups return faster; false positives fall through safely. No API changes are required on your side. Verify your plugin against the staging build referenced below.

session token of fahif-tadup = htk3_9c7

## Releases

To cut a release of Tilecourier, the map-tile prefetcher, bump the version in prefetch.toml, regenerate the tile manifest, and run the full cache-warming test suite against the staging region. Tag the commit with a v-prefixed semver tag. The publish workflow builds artifacts for all three platforms and uploads them, but the registry rejects unsigned uploads. Sign the release artifacts using the key below.

deploy key for kajof-fajop: bky6_gDHw9Q

Hey — before you can review my branch, heads up: the Brimworth secrets vault that holds the QueueLift scaling tokens locked itself again after the cert rotation. The autoscaler reads queue-depth metrics from Pondermill, and without the vault open, the integration tests just hang, so don't blame your review env. I already pinged the platform folks; they said any reviewer can unseal it themselves. Pop open the vault CLI, pick the QueueLift realm, and paste in the recovery passphrase below.

vault phrase of tagaf-hawef = jordor-wenok-gorael-wenion-keleth-sorion-wenys-novix-fenir-fraax-fenael-aldius-fraok

// Client setup for the Remindrel appointment-reminder job at the Hollowpine
// Clinic deployment. The job runs every morning at 06:30 local time, pulls
// tomorrow's appointments from the scheduling service, and queues SMS and
// email reminders. Retries are capped at three per patient to avoid
// duplicate sends during partial outages. The client authenticates to the
// internal Remindrel gateway using the API key that appears on the next line.

app token of yahog-tajop = zpat7_G3yZ3Zf